What Electrolux Offers In Central Vacuum Systems

Table of Contents

Electrolux central vacuum systems are available in a variety of product lines. Their systems are designed to be efficient and quiet with features tailor-fit for every size of a home. There are three models in their Oxygen line which have different features and performance levels.

The Oxygen product line


The three Electrolux central vacuum systems lines differ when it comes to the power unit. The base model is the Oxygen Model ELUX910 which is rated at 600 air watts. The mid-sized model is Oxygen ELUX920 which has 675 air watts and the most powerful unit is the Oxygen ELUX930 which has 700 air watts of power.

These systems also differ when it comes to interacting with the power unit. The base model just has an on/off light while the mid-sized model comes with an LED display to let you make adjustments. The top model has an integrated LCD display screen allowing for fine-tuning features such as the suction power.

Features of all three models


The Electrolux vacuums all come with an eclipse power nozzle. This nozzle has a vent on the front that can be adjusted. This modifies the airflow allowing for less or more suction power. The nozzle also includes a floating brush roll that will go up or down depending on what you are using one of the Electrolux vacuums on.

Each of the Electrolux central vacuums also comes with an ergonomically designed hose handle. This allows you to comfortably vacuum without the power nozzle attached if you just want to use the hose.

Electrolux central vacuum accessories


There are a number of accessories for the Electrolux central vacuums. They sell kits that have a 30 to 35 foot hose. There are multiple powerheads available that each specializes in a particular surface. There is a soft-brush dust mop for hardwood floors and powerhead wand attachments designed for drapes and furniture. Other attachments are made to reach into crevices and other hard to access spaces.

The cost of a central vacuuming system



Depending on what model of power unit you use and how many wall inlets you need a central vacuum system will set you back between $1,200 and $3,000. This includes the power unit, vacuum tubes, wall inlets, and the hose. The additional accessories are available singly or in kits that come with several of the attachments grouped together.
